How Lighting Changes Harbor Haze
At LRV 62, Harbor Haze is a light color that bounces daylight around a room without tipping into stark white. Its teal und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. It holds its undertone in most exposures, which is what makes light shades like this so forgiving room to room.

Need It From Another Brand?
Any paint counter can custom-tint Benjamin Moore 2136-60 directly. If you would rather stay in one brand's own deck, these are the closest stock matches, measured as ΔE2000. Under 2 is a difference you will not see on the wall.
| Brand | Closest color | ΔE | LRV |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Sherwin-Williams | TidewaterSW 6477 · Sherwin-Williams | 2.4 | 65 | Color page → |
| Behr | Tranquil SeaPPL-73 · Behr | 2.5 | 63 | Color page → |
| Valspar | Aquatic Edge5003-5A · Valspar | 2.6 | 64.8 | Color page → |
| PPG / Glidden | Sky DivingPPG1035-2 · PPG / Glidden | 1.2 | 64 | Color page → |
| Glidden | Scandinavian SkyPPG1149-3 · Glidden | 1.5 | 63 | Color page → |
| Dutch Boy | Silver Shores430-2DB · Dutch Boy | 2.9 | 63 | Color page → |
